Chromatogram and peak integration

The figure is drawn from the table. It is not an independent illustration — if a number in the table changed, the trace would change with it.

02280456068399119 Retatrutide11.19 min · 97.98 % 12.3910.86 same trace · ×50 vertical expansion, baseline-corrected · main peak off-scale reporting threshold 0.05 % area 048121620 Retention time (min) Response (mAU)
Figure 1. RP-HPLC trace, 15 min gradient, 214 nm. Drawn from the peak-integration table below: peak positions are the reported retention times, peak areas are the reported area percentages, peak widths follow the reported plate count of 68,052, and skew follows the reported asymmetry factor of 1.32. Baseline noise is seeded from the report ID and is illustrative. The lower panel is the same trace at a stated vertical expansion with the slow gradient drift subtracted, because at full scale a 0.89 % impurity against a 97.98 % main peak is a line two pixels tall; the main peak runs off-scale there by design.

Gravimetric mass balance

Water, counter-ion, residual and total peptide content are exhaustive and mutually exclusive categories. They must account for 100 % of the cake mass. The index closes this to within 0.02 pp and the build asserts it.

Signed technical comments from index contributors. Not a discussion forum — annotations question or contextualise the result, and the data team replies where a reply is warranted.

mass_defect
Mass-defect reasoning narrows this quickly. Very few plausible modifications of Retatrutide would produce a shift in the direction and magnitude observed, and the ones that would are all in the named-impurity table.
nmr_qnmr
Where mass spectrometry is unhelpful, quantitative NMR is orthogonal and does not care about ionisation. It is expensive and it is the correct next step on a record like this.
quad_unit
The purity, water and counter-ion figures on this record stand regardless of the mass question. Only the identity limb is affected, and the status field says exactly that.
